The Front Runner

Plot:
Gary Hart’s (Hugh Jackman) presidential campaign in 1988 is derailed when he’s caught having an affair. 

Pros:
•There is a lot to like about this movie. For one thing the performances. Hugh Jackman is amazing as always. There are some great moments between him and the strong supporting cast, especially Vera Farmiga and JK Simmons. 
•Jason Reitman does direct this well, although it’s far from his best movie. He really did make it look and feel like the 80s. 
•The score is subtle yet effective. 
•There’s some great bits of dialog. 

Cons:
•Overall though I felt that the script was kind of weak. 
•They spend way too much time developing the supporting cast (not that it wasn’t interesting, it was) and not enough time on the main character. 
•Could’ve used another round of editing. 
•I’m not sure if it was the theater I saw it in but if it wasn’t- the sound mixing was awful at times, especially in the beginning. It was hard to make out what some of the characters were saying. 
•Is it worth seeing? Sure. But I wouldn’t rush out or anything. 

My Rating: 6.5/10
